Color Palettes That Complement Light Floors

Choosing the right color palette can make your light-colored floors stand out beautifully. The colors you select for walls, furniture, and decor either enhance the brightness or add depth to your space. Let’s look at some palettes that work well with light floors to help you create a mood you love.

Neutral Shades For A Calm Ambiance

Neutral colors like beige, soft gray, and creamy white blend seamlessly with light floors. These shades create a peaceful and relaxing atmosphere, perfect for bedrooms or living rooms where you want to unwind.

Try adding textured fabrics or natural materials like wood and linen to keep the space from feeling flat. Have you noticed how a simple beige sofa against pale floors can make your room feel both cozy and spacious?

Bold Colors For Vibrant Spaces

If you want to energize your room, bold colors like navy blue, emerald green, or deep reds offer striking contrast against light floors. These colors draw attention and bring personality to your space.

Use bold tones on accent walls, rugs, or statement furniture pieces to avoid overwhelming the room. Can you imagine how a bright red armchair pops against a light wood floor, instantly becoming the room’s focal point?

Pastels For Soft And Airy Looks

Pastel colors such as blush pink, mint green, and soft lavender complement light floors with a gentle, airy feel. These hues keep your space feeling fresh and inviting without overpowering the natural brightness.

Mix pastel cushions, curtains, or art pieces to add subtle color layers that enhance your light flooring. What if you added a pale blue rug—would it make your room feel more open and serene?

Furniture Styles To Match Light Flooring

Choosing furniture that complements light colored floors enhances the overall aesthetic. Light flooring offers a neutral base, making it versatile for various styles. Let’s explore how different furniture styles can harmonize with light floors.

Modern Minimalist Pieces

Modern minimalist furniture shines on light floors. Clean lines and simple shapes create an open feel. Use pieces with neutral tones like white, gray, or beige. This maintains a serene and uncluttered space. Minimalist designs often incorporate metal or glass elements. These materials add a sleek touch to the room.

Rustic And Farmhouse Elements

Rustic and farmhouse furniture adds warmth to light floors. Wooden pieces with distressed finishes create a cozy vibe. Opt for furniture in natural wood tones. These complement the light flooring beautifully. Add soft textures through woven fabrics or plush cushions. This style brings a homey, inviting feel.

Mid-century Modern Accents

Mid-century modern furniture offers a stylish contrast to light floors. Pieces with tapered legs and smooth curves bring elegance. Choose furniture in warm wood tones or vibrant colors. These add character and depth to the space. Incorporating vintage elements enhances the mid-century charm. This style is timeless and sophisticated.

Textiles And Rugs To Enhance Light Floors

Textiles and rugs bring warmth and character to rooms with light-colored floors. They soften the space and create inviting areas. Choosing the right textiles can highlight the brightness of the floor while adding comfort and style.

Rugs and textiles also help define spaces and add layers to your design. They offer a way to introduce patterns, colors, and textures without overwhelming the light floor. This section guides you on enhancing light floors with textiles and rugs.

Choosing The Right Rug Patterns

Select patterns that complement light floors. Subtle patterns like soft geometrics or delicate florals work well. Avoid overly dark or busy patterns that can clash or overpower the floor’s brightness.

Consider rugs with:

  • Neutral tones mixed with soft colors
  • Simple stripes or checks
  • Lightly distressed or vintage designs

These choices keep the floor as a focal point while adding interest.

Layering Textures For Depth

Mixing textures creates depth and a cozy feel. Combine smooth fabrics with nubby or shaggy rugs. Use soft cushions, throws, and woven textiles to add softness.

Try layering:

  • A flatweave rug under a plush area rug
  • Velvet pillows with linen throws
  • Natural fibers like jute or sisal

This approach adds richness without darkening the space.

Color Coordination Tips

Coordinate colors to balance the light floors. Use colors that enhance the floor’s tone. Cool shades like blues and greens create calmness. Warm tones like soft yellows and peach add warmth.

Follow these tips:

  • Match rug colors with wall or furniture accents
  • Use lighter colors to keep the room airy
  • Add small pops of contrasting color for energy

Balanced colors make the room feel harmonious and inviting.

Wall Art And Decor Ideas

Choosing the right wall art and decor can transform your space with light-colored floors into a warm, inviting haven. The key is to create contrast and texture without overpowering the subtle elegance of your flooring. Here’s how you can style your walls to complement those pale, airy floors.

Framed Prints And Canvases

Bold framed prints add personality to rooms with light floors. Opt for darker frames like black, navy, or deep wood tones to create a striking contrast against pale walls and floors. A gallery wall with a mix of sizes and styles can bring a dynamic feel without cluttering the space.

Try prints with vibrant colors or rich textures to break the monotony. I once added a large abstract canvas with splashes of teal and gold above my sofa, and it instantly lifted the entire room’s mood. Could your walls use a pop of color to energize your space?

Mirrors To Amplify Light

Mirrors are more than decorative—they reflect light and make rooms feel larger. Place a mirror opposite a window to bounce natural light across your light floors and brighten up darker corners. Choose frames that complement your floor tone; for example, soft metallics or distressed wood work beautifully.

Try a round or oval mirror to soften sharp lines in a modern room. Have you noticed how a well-placed mirror can change the whole vibe of your living area?

Shelving And Decorative Objects

Floating shelves provide space to showcase decorative objects without overwhelming the room. Use shelves to display small plants, candles, or curated collections that add layers of interest. Light floors call for decor in warm tones or natural materials like ceramics and woven baskets to keep the look grounded.

Think about mixing textures—a ceramic vase, a stack of books, and a small framed photo can create an inviting vignette. What little treasures can you bring out to personalize your space while keeping the airy feel?


Lighting Solutions For Bright Floors

Bright floors create an open, airy atmosphere in any room. Choosing the right lighting enhances this effect, balancing brightness and warmth. Lighting solutions for light-colored floors focus on maximizing natural light, selecting the right bulb tones, and using eye-catching fixtures.

Natural Light Maximization

Natural light highlights the beauty of light floors. Use sheer curtains to let sunlight in while keeping privacy. Mirrors reflect light, making spaces feel larger and brighter. Arrange furniture to avoid blocking windows. Keep windows clean to allow maximum light through.

Warm Vs Cool Lighting Choices

Warm lighting adds coziness to bright floors. It softens the look and creates a welcoming feel. Cool lighting keeps a room modern and fresh. It enhances the clean, crisp look of light floors. Choose lighting based on room use and mood desired.

Statement Light Fixtures

Bold light fixtures add character to rooms with light floors. Pendant lights or chandeliers become focal points. Choose fixtures with interesting shapes or materials. They contrast nicely with simple, bright flooring. Use dimmable lights to adjust brightness as needed.

Greenery And Natural Elements

Light colored floors create a bright and airy base that opens up your space. Adding greenery and natural elements can bring life and texture to this clean canvas. These touches make your room feel inviting and balanced without overpowering the subtle elegance of pale flooring.

Indoor Plants That Pop

Green plants stand out beautifully against light floors. Think about placing tall fiddle leaf figs or snake plants in simple pots near windows. Their deep green leaves contrast sharply, drawing the eye and adding freshness.

Smaller succulents or ferns work well on shelves or coffee tables. You might be surprised how just a few well-placed plants can change the mood of a room. Are you giving your space enough natural life?

Wood Accents To Add Warmth

Wood accents balance the coolness of light floors. Choose furniture with natural wood tones like oak, teak, or walnut to introduce warmth and depth. Even small touches, such as wooden picture frames or a rustic side table, soften the look.

Consider mixing different wood finishes to create visual interest without overwhelming the light base. Have you noticed how a wooden chair or bench instantly makes a room cozier?

Stone And Ceramic Decor Pieces

Stone and ceramic items bring texture and an organic feel to your décor. Look for matte-finish vases, bowls, or candle holders in neutral tones like beige, gray, or soft white. These pieces add subtle contrast and highlight the simplicity of light floors.

Try grouping a few stone or ceramic items together for a curated look. How often do you use tactile elements to enhance your space’s personality?
